加入收藏 | 设为首页 | 会员中心 | 我要投稿 51站长网 (https://www.51jishu.cn/)- 云服务器、高性能计算、边缘计算、数据迁移、业务安全!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L数据一致性保障策略与实现

发布时间:2025-09-26 08:23:43 所属栏目:MySql教程 来源:DaWei
导读: 在构建高可用的MySQL架构时,数据一致性是保障系统稳定运行的核心要素之一。云环境下的MySQL实例往往面临多节点、分布式部署等复杂场景,因此需要设计合理的数据一致性保障策略。 事务机制是确保数据一致性的

在构建高可用的MySQL架构时,数据一致性是保障系统稳定运行的核心要素之一。云环境下的MySQL实例往往面临多节点、分布式部署等复杂场景,因此需要设计合理的数据一致性保障策略。


事务机制是确保数据一致性的基础。通过ACID特性,MySQL能够保证单个事务内的操作要么全部成功,要么全部失败。在云环境中,合理配置事务隔离级别,可以有效避免脏读、不可重复读和幻读等问题。


主从复制是实现数据同步的重要手段。通过配置主库的binlog,并让从库实时应用这些日志,可以实现数据的异步复制。但需要注意的是,网络延迟或主从延迟可能导致短暂的数据不一致,需结合监控工具进行及时处理。


AI设计稿,仅供参考

高可用架构中,引入集群技术如MHA(Master High Availability)或PXC(Percona XtraDB Cluster)能够提升系统的容灾能力。这些方案在故障切换时能尽量保持数据的一致性,减少数据丢失的风险。


数据备份与恢复策略同样不可忽视。定期全量备份与增量备份相结合,配合可靠的恢复流程,能够在数据异常时快速回滚到一致状态。同时,备份过程应尽量减少对生产环境的影响。


最终,数据一致性保障需要结合业务需求与技术选型,制定合适的策略并持续优化。云安全架构师应关注底层技术细节,同时也要理解上层业务逻辑,才能真正实现高效可靠的数据管理。

(编辑:51站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章